Hey — handover on the Portwhistle FD leak hunt. Short version: descriptors climb about 40/hour under load, flatten overnight. I've ruled out the upload path; my money's on the retry wrapper around the Brindlecast client not closing sockets on timeout. Repro script is in the tools repo, run it against staging only. The instance I've been testing carries the following configuration.

settings of tagef-bawif:
DRUIX_HOST=druix.zemvarlabs.internal
DRUIX_PORT=8000

**Vendor note: Inkmill markdown pipeline**

Rendering for Parchway docs is outsourced to Inkmill under an annual contract, renewing each March. They handle sanitization and PDF export; we own the upload queue. SLA: 4-hour response on rendering failures. Escalate only after two failed retries. Their support desk is reachable at the address below.

billing contact of hahaf-baguf = zorael.tammir.jorius@sivrelhq.internal

Finance Review Summary — Logistics Provider Transition

Prepared for the incoming director. This quarter we completed the switch from Harlowe Freight to Northquay Logistics. Transition costs totalled slightly above forecast, driven by dual-running warehouses through the overlap period. Per-shipment cost is now 12% lower, and damage claims have halved. Contractual exit fees were settled in full, and no disputes remain open. One sensitive item requires your attention before the board pack circulates.

board note of baweg-bawig: Project Tamath slips by six weeks because of the audit delay.